Analysis: Helsinki vs Cork for Expats & Remote Workers
Our data shows Cork is approximately 5% more affordable than Helsinki when combining rent and daily living costs. Helsinki's COL+Rent Index of 53.7 vs Cork's 51.2 (both measured against New York City = 100) reflects a relatively small gap, meaning the decision between these cities often comes down to lifestyle preferences rather than pure cost.
Housing is the biggest differentiator: a city-center one-bedroom in Helsinki costs $1,280/month versus $1,714/month in Cork — giving Helsinki a $434/month advantage on housing alone. Over a full year, this rent difference alone amounts to $5,208 in annual savings.
Day-to-day costs tell a more nuanced story. Groceries in Helsinki ($483/mo) vs Cork ($321/mo) reflect Cork's lower food prices, while restaurant meals at $22 vs $18 show Cork offers cheaper dining. For digital nomads and remote workers who eat out frequently, this difference compounds quickly.
